Output 83b81e5083d1307d61c358b5dd9fa5b2300d1cc285e212c46275203e64fb47bd:0

value
1370816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0eceaae241fb34e85e22ef67424fa1ab439cf6a OP_EQUAL
address
3PeuuqyvPeEKQKM8eoGYJvBNiwYvgzAfNa
transaction
83b81e5083d1307d61c358b5dd9fa5b2300d1cc285e212c46275203e64fb47bd
confirmations
300210
spent
true